Shubh Muhurat and Auspicious Timings for Ganesh Chaturthi 2026

Here’s the thing about Vedic rituals — timing matters. Like, *a lot*.
The muhurat is your spiritual Wi-Fi window. Miss it, and sometimes the signal’s weak.

For 2026, Chaturthi Tithi starts at 4:18 AM on September 14 and ends at 1:12 AM on September 15.
But the golden slot? Abhijit Muhurat11:48 AM to 12:36 PM on the 14th. That’s your prime time for Ganesh Sthapana.
If you can’t make it? No panic. Any time during Chaturthi Tithi before sunset works.

Step-by-Step Ganesh Chaturthi Puja Vidhi: A Simple Guide for Homes

Let me tell you — you don’t need a priest. Or a 50-page manual.
Modern life’s busy.
So here’s a stripped-down, real-life version of puja vidhi I’ve taught families for years.

Step 1: Cleanse the Space
Sweep. Wipe. Clear the clutter — physical *and* mental.
Use water + a splash of gangajal to purify the area. (And yes, a little tap water works if you don’t have Ganga water — don’t stress.)
Light a ghee diya. That flame? It’s not just light. It’s awareness waking up.

Step 2: Install the Idol
East or north-facing. Red or yellow cloth underneath — energy colours.
And please — use clay. Not plaster. Not plastic.

Step 3: Invoke the Deity (Pran Pratishtha)
Fill a kalash with water. Top it with mango leaves and coconut.
Chant:
“Om Shreem Hreem Kleem Glaum Gam Ganapataye Vara Varada Sarva Janan Mein Vashamanaya Swaha”
Then — gently — touch the idol’s eyes, mouth, heart with kusha grass or a flower.
It’s like saying: *Wake up. We’re glad you’re here.*

Step 4: Offerings (Naivedya)
21 modaks? Ideal.
But I had a client once — retired teacher — offered just two. Said, “I made them with my granddaughter. That’s my 21.”
Bappa smiled. I know he did.
You can also offer coconut, jaggery, fruits, and 21 blades of durva grass.

Fasting Rules and What to Eat During Ganesh Chaturthi

Fasting — or upvas — isn’t about starvation. It’s about detox. Mind, body, ego.
Common to fast on day one and day ten. No grains. No onion. No garlic.
Eat phalahar — fruits, milk, yogurt, singhare ka atta (water chestnut flour), kuttu (buckwheat).

Powerful Mantras to Chant During Ganesh Chaturthi 2026

Mantras aren’t magic spells. They’re vibrations. Tuning forks for the soul. (Want personalized guidance? Chat with AI Guru Ji on Kundli Life)

My go-tos:

Om Gam Ganapataye Namah
I bow to Lord Ganesha
Chant 108 times daily, if you can. With a rudraksha mala. Clears mental fog. Like wiping a dusty mirror.

Om Shreem Hreem Kleem Glaum Ganeshaya Svaha
Invoking Ganesha’s full power for success and protection
Use this when starting something new. A job. A journey. A forgiveness. (Also read: Ultimate Guide to Raksha Bandhan 2026 Date Muhurat Puja Vidhi)

“Vakratunda Mahakaya Suryakoti Samaprabha”
O Lord with the curved trunk and massive body, radiant as a million suns, destroy my obstacles
From the Ganesha Atharvashirsha. I say this every morning during Chaturthi. Feels like armor.

And of course — the aarti:
“Sukhakarta Dukhaharta, Namami Vinayakar”
The giver of happiness, the remover of sorrow, I bow to you, O Vinayaka
